Ahmed Seeks Establishment Of Security Trust Fund

Date: 2012-04-27

Kwara State governor,  Alhaji  AbdulFatah Ahmed yesterday, advocated for the establishment of Security Trust Funds by the three tiers of government to ensure adequate funding of the nation's security needs.

Ahmed made the suggestion in Ilorin, the state capital, while declaring open the meeting of the Federal and States Security Administrators (FSSAM).

The governor who was represented by his deputy, Elder Peter Kisira, said the establishment of the Security Trust Funds would enable government at all levels to render sufficient assistance to security agencies in order to enhance and sustain their combat readiness.

The governor stressed the need for all stakeholders to make contributions into the funds for efficient and transparent management.

Ahmed said peace and security should be recognised as necessary ingredients for rapid socio-economic development of any country or state, urging government at all levels to fully get involved and adopt strategies that would nip in the bud any untoward security challenges.           

He called on participants to bring their wealth of experience to bear on security issues and management and also proffer solutions to security issues that retard the growth and development of the country.
